Lines Matching full:pv_api_ip
136 void *pv_api_ip,
138 WORD32 ih264d_set_num_cores(iv_obj_t *dec_hdl, void *pv_api_ip, void *pv_api_op);
148 void *pv_api_ip,
155 void *pv_api_ip,
166 if(NULL == pv_api_ip)
169 pu4_api_ip = (UWORD32 *)pv_api_ip;
223 ih264d_create_ip_t *ps_ip = (ih264d_create_ip_t *)pv_api_ip;
278 (ih264d_get_display_frame_ip_t *)pv_api_ip;
313 (ih264d_rel_display_frame_ip_t *)pv_api_ip;
349 (ih264d_set_display_frame_ip_t *)pv_api_ip;
434 (ih264d_video_decode_ip_t *)pv_api_ip;
470 (ih264d_delete_ip_t *)pv_api_ip;
504 pu4_ptr_cmd = (UWORD32 *)pv_api_ip;
514 ps_ip = (ih264d_ctl_set_config_ip_t *)pv_api_ip;
549 ps_ip = (ih264d_ctl_getstatus_ip_t *)pv_api_ip;
576 ps_ip = (ih264d_ctl_getbufinfo_ip_t *)pv_api_ip;
604 ps_ip = (ih264d_ctl_getversioninfo_ip_t *)pv_api_ip;
631 ps_ip = (ih264d_ctl_flush_ip_t *)pv_api_ip;
658 ps_ip = (ih264d_ctl_reset_ip_t *)pv_api_ip;
686 ps_ip = (ih264d_ctl_degrade_ip_t *)pv_api_ip;
723 ps_ip = (ih264d_ctl_get_frame_dimensions_ip_t *)pv_api_ip;
752 ps_ip = (ih264d_ctl_set_num_cores_ip_t *)pv_api_ip;
785 ps_ip = (ih264d_ctl_set_processor_ip_t *)pv_api_ip;
832 * @param[in] pv_api_ip
846 WORD32 ih264d_set_processor(iv_obj_t *dec_hdl, void *pv_api_ip, void *pv_api_op)
852 ps_ip = (ih264d_ctl_set_processor_ip_t *)pv_api_ip;
1168 /* :pv_api_ip pointer to input structure */
1181 WORD32 ih264d_allocate_static_bufs(iv_obj_t **dec_hdl, void *pv_api_ip, void *pv_api_op)
1193 ps_create_ip = (ih264d_create_ip_t *)pv_api_ip;
1447 /* :pv_api_ip pointer to input structure */
1460 WORD32 ih264d_create(iv_obj_t *dec_hdl, void *pv_api_ip, void *pv_api_op)
1470 ret = ih264d_allocate_static_bufs(&dec_hdl, pv_api_ip, pv_api_op);
1602 /* :pv_api_ip pointer to input structure */
1616 WORD32 ih264d_video_decode(iv_obj_t *dec_hdl, void *pv_api_ip, void *pv_api_op)
1639 ps_dec_ip = (ivd_video_decode_ip_t *)pv_api_ip;
2396 WORD32 ih264d_get_version(iv_obj_t *dec_hdl, void *pv_api_ip, void *pv_api_op)
2404 ps_ip = (ivd_ctl_getversioninfo_ip_t *)pv_api_ip;
2439 /* :pv_api_ip pointer to input structure */
2453 void *pv_api_ip,
2458 UNUSED(pv_api_ip);
2471 /* :pv_api_ip pointer to input structure */
2485 void *pv_api_ip,
2495 dec_disp_ip = (ivd_set_display_frame_ip_t *)pv_api_ip;
2540 /* :pv_api_ip pointer to input structure */
2554 WORD32 ih264d_set_flush_mode(iv_obj_t *dec_hdl, void *pv_api_ip, void *pv_api_op)
2561 UNUSED(pv_api_ip);
2584 /* :pv_api_ip pointer to input structure */
2599 WORD32 ih264d_get_status(iv_obj_t *dec_hdl, void *pv_api_ip, void *pv_api_op)
2606 UNUSED(pv_api_ip);
2761 /* :pv_api_ip pointer to input structure */
2775 WORD32 ih264d_get_buf_info(iv_obj_t *dec_hdl, void *pv_api_ip, void *pv_api_op)
2783 UNUSED(pv_api_ip);
2913 /* :pv_api_ip pointer to input structure */
2926 WORD32 ih264d_set_params(iv_obj_t *dec_hdl, void *pv_api_ip, void *pv_api_op)
2933 (ivd_ctl_set_config_ip_t *)pv_api_ip;
3035 /* :pv_api_ip pointer to input structure */
3049 void *pv_api_ip,
3059 UNUSED(pv_api_ip);
3080 /* :pv_api_ip pointer to input structure */
3094 WORD32 ih264d_delete(iv_obj_t *dec_hdl, void *pv_api_ip, void *pv_api_op)
3097 ih264d_delete_ip_t *ps_ip = (ih264d_delete_ip_t *)pv_api_ip;
3114 /* :pv_api_ip pointer to input structure */
3128 WORD32 ih264d_reset(iv_obj_t *dec_hdl, void *pv_api_ip, void *pv_api_op)
3132 UNUSED(pv_api_ip);
3158 /* :pv_api_ip pointer to input structure */
3171 WORD32 ih264d_ctl(iv_obj_t *dec_hdl, void *pv_api_ip, void *pv_api_op)
3184 ps_ctl_ip = (ivd_ctl_set_config_ip_t*)pv_api_ip;
3192 ret = ih264d_get_status(dec_hdl, (void *)pv_api_ip,
3196 ret = ih264d_set_params(dec_hdl, (void *)pv_api_ip,
3200 ret = ih264d_reset(dec_hdl, (void *)pv_api_ip, (void *)pv_api_op);
3203 ret = ih264d_set_default_params(dec_hdl, (void *)pv_api_ip,
3207 ret = ih264d_set_flush_mode(dec_hdl, (void *)pv_api_ip,
3211 ret = ih264d_get_buf_info(dec_hdl, (void *)pv_api_ip,
3215 ret = ih264d_get_version(dec_hdl, (void *)pv_api_ip,
3219 ret = ih264d_set_degrade(dec_hdl, (void *)pv_api_ip,
3224 ret = ih264d_set_num_cores(dec_hdl, (void *)pv_api_ip,
3228 ret = ih264d_get_frame_dimensions(dec_hdl, (void *)pv_api_ip,
3232 ret = ih264d_set_processor(dec_hdl, (void *)pv_api_ip,
3250 /* :pv_api_ip pointer to input structure */
3264 void *pv_api_ip,
3275 ps_rel_ip = (ivd_rel_display_frame_ip_t *)pv_api_ip;
3318 * @param[in] pv_api_ip
3333 void *pv_api_ip,
3340 ps_ip = (ih264d_ctl_degrade_ip_t *)pv_api_ip;
3354 void *pv_api_ip,
3362 ps_ip = (ih264d_ctl_get_frame_dimensions_ip_t *)pv_api_ip;
3458 WORD32 ih264d_set_num_cores(iv_obj_t *dec_hdl, void *pv_api_ip, void *pv_api_op)
3464 ps_ip = (ih264d_ctl_set_num_cores_ip_t *)pv_api_ip;
3521 /* :pv_api_ip pointer to input structure */
3535 void *pv_api_ip,
3542 e_status = api_check_struct_sanity(dec_hdl, pv_api_ip, pv_api_op);
3554 pu2_ptr_cmd = (UWORD32 *)pv_api_ip;
3563 u4_api_ret = ih264d_create(dec_hdl, (void *)pv_api_ip,
3567 u4_api_ret = ih264d_delete(dec_hdl, (void *)pv_api_ip,
3572 u4_api_ret = ih264d_video_decode(dec_hdl, (void *)pv_api_ip,
3577 u4_api_ret = ih264d_get_display_frame(dec_hdl, (void *)pv_api_ip,
3583 u4_api_ret = ih264d_set_display_frame(dec_hdl, (void *)pv_api_ip,
3589 u4_api_ret = ih264d_rel_display_frame(dec_hdl, (void *)pv_api_ip,
3594 u4_api_ret = ih264d_ctl(dec_hdl, (void *)pv_api_ip,